summaryrefslogtreecommitdiff
path: root/mk
diff options
context:
space:
mode:
authorAbdoulaye Walsimou Gaye <awg@embtoolkit.org>2012-01-14 14:12:04 +0100
committerAbdoulaye Walsimou Gaye <awg@embtoolkit.org>2012-01-14 14:12:04 +0100
commit26b659e9b2f81cd0de36515d174329d32c7693bf (patch)
tree94af30ce4f7c977429b93a56641f32c44bef3bc8 /mk
parent72a92086cf2fc1fb432cf7469eb4f19e23a8f194 (diff)
downloadembtoolkit-26b659e9b2f81cd0de36515d174329d32c7693bf.tar.gz
embtoolkit-26b659e9b2f81cd0de36515d174329d32c7693bf.tar.bz2
embtoolkit-26b659e9b2f81cd0de36515d174329d32c7693bf.tar.xz
Toolchain: if cached toolchain is used, fake gcc3 stage install
Signed-off-by: Abdoulaye Walsimou Gaye <awg@embtoolkit.org>
Diffstat (limited to 'mk')
-rw-r--r--mk/toolchain.mk5
1 files changed, 5 insertions, 0 deletions
diff --git a/mk/toolchain.mk b/mk/toolchain.mk
index b2dd60b..c4191fb 100644
--- a/mk/toolchain.mk
+++ b/mk/toolchain.mk
@@ -121,6 +121,11 @@ define __embtk_toolchain_decompress
$(call embtk_pinfo,"Decompressing $(GNU_TARGET)/$(EMBTK_MCU_FLAG) toolchain - please wait...")
cd $(EMBTK_ROOT) && tar xjf $(TOOLCHAIN_DIR)/$(TOOLCHAIN_PACKAGE)
$(MAKE) $(TOOLCHAIN_POST_DEPS)
+ mkdir -p $(GCC3_BUILD_DIR)
+ touch $(GCC3_BUILD_DIR)/.installed
+ touch $(GCC3_BUILD_DIR)/.gcc3_post_install
+ $(MAKE) __embtk_gcc3_printmetakconfigs > \
+ $(call __embtk_pkg_dotpkgkconfig_f,gcc3)
endef
define __embtk_toolchain_build